SACRAMENTO (CBS13) — It’s the time of year for many students to think about heading off to university and their next chapter.

A 12-year-old boy has already won a regents scholarship to continue college and he has even bigger dreams.

It began with a love of dinosaurs, and the next thing you know, Tanishq Abraham was asking his parents to allow him to take a college course. He was 6 years old.

“It’s like, you’re 6 years old and you want to take a college class,” his mother said. “So we just laughed it off.”

But at age 7, he came back and convinced Mom and Dad to ask American River College about attending a class.

He’ll be a junior transfer student when he enrolls in either UC Davis or UC Santa Cruz. He received acceptances to the University of California, Santa Cruz, and the University of California, Davis. He plans to study bio-engineering. “I’m pretty excited,” Tanishq told NBC News on Saturday. “I’ve been waiting for this for quite some time now. I’ll finally be working on my bachelor’s. It’s very exciting.” He hasn’t yet decided which school he’ll go to, but the wunderkind is no stranger to being the youngest pupil in class. Last year, at 11 years-old, Tanishq earned three associate’s degrees from American River College, a community college in Sacramento, where he was believed to be the youngest graduate ever. He graduated top of his class. He got his high school diploma a year prior, an accomplishment that earned him a letter of recognition from President Barack Obama.
